With some great up and coming local acts on the bill tonight, The Old Bar is the place to be.

Organised after a last minute cancellation just a couple of days ago, up-and-coming acts Squid inc. and Grevillea Hedge are playing at The Old Bar tonight. With doors at 8pm and tickets being $15, it’s a great way to spend a Friday evening and support some local acts.

Tucked away on Johnston Street, The Old Bar has always been a place where artists and performers alike have united over a shared love of art and music. With an art gallery upstairs that showcases new exhibitions every fortnight and a new live act to catch literally every week of the night, it’s the perfect place to go on a Tuesday or Wednesday when nothing else is on.

With one of the venue’s owners Joel Morrison booking the bands personally, they’ve hosted a massive variety of big name local acts as well as consistently showcasing some of the best underground and up-and-coming stuff that the city has to offer.

“King Gizz, Courtney Barnett, Wil Wagner and The Smith Street Band have done residencies,” Joel says. “Cash Savage still plays here lots, Graveyard Train, Brothers Grimm. There have been so many shows. There have been at least nine shows a week for ten years.”

The owners of The Old Bar also run The Carringbush Hotel in Abbotsford, a cosy venue with plant-based meals, art, live music and Taco Tuesday seven days a week. Visit them on Johnston Street for a great evening out or, you could even catch them on the field as The Old Bar Unicorns also play in the Renegade Pub Footy League at Victoria Park – a not-for-profit community organisation that operates a gender-inclusive Aussie Rules league in Melbourne’s north.
